Transaction 377527e5635690be61afb779c48af777cd9ed317249b5a8f01b88c9d22d77318
1 Input
1 Output
-
377527e5635690be61afb779c48af777cd9ed317249b5a8f01b88c9d22d77318:0
- value
- 63090
- script pubkey
- OP_0 OP_PUSHBYTES_20 869eb75caa7e6fa52f5eb0dbf5c031502c7d371f
- address
- bc1qs60twh920eh62t67krdltsp32qk86dcl6se4tt